Email Automation Engine

A job application email automation system with two implementations:

  1. Google Apps Script (Code_Rewritten.gs) — runs inside Google Sheets with a built-in UI (sidebars, modals, triggers)
  2. Standalone Node.js Web App (standalone/) — a self-hosted Express server with a browser-based UI

Features

  • Contact Management — Import contacts from .xlsx, .xls, or .csv files; add/edit/delete manually; search & paginate; export to CSV
  • Email Templates — Pre-built templates (formal, friendly, job-post, referral, LinkedIn) with {{name}}, {{company}}, {{role_name}} personalization placeholders
  • Draft Generation — Create email drafts one at a time or in bulk with randomized delays to avoid spam detection
  • Scheduled Sending — Schedule emails with staggered send times; background scheduler checks every 30 seconds for due emails
  • Daily Send Limits — Configurable daily cap (default 50) with automatic counter reset
  • Retry Logic — Failed emails are retried up to 2 times with a 1-minute delay
  • Email Blocklist — Block specific emails or entire domains
  • Audit Log — Tracks all actions (logins, imports, sends, edits) with timestamps and IP addresses
  • Real-time Progress — Server-Sent Events (SSE) for live progress updates during bulk operations
  • Unsubscribe Footer — Optional unsubscribe text appended to outgoing emails

Google Apps Script Version

The Apps Script version (Code_Rewritten.gs) is designed to run as a bound script inside a Google Sheets spreadsheet with these sheets:

Sheet Purpose
Job Tracker Main contact/application data (columns A-Y)
Contacts Networking contacts (columns A-J)
Data Email templates (subject, initial, follow-up, last follow-up)
Email Log Send history and status tracking

Key capabilities

  • Custom menu and sidebar UI within Google Sheets
  • Gmail draft creation and direct sending via GmailApp / MailApp
  • Time-based triggers for scheduled batch sends and safety checks
  • Open/click tracking via a deployed web app endpoint
  • Daily send counter using PropertiesService

Standalone Web App

Tech Stack

  • Runtime: Node.js
  • Server: Express
  • Database: SQLite via sql.js (file: data/tracker.db)
  • Email: Nodemailer (SMTP) or Gmail API (OAuth 2.0)
  • Auth: OTP-based email login or Google OAuth
  • Security: Helmet, rate limiting, session management, input sanitization

Project Structure

standalone/
  server.js            # Express app, all API routes
  config.js            # Environment variables and defaults
  db.js                # SQLite database layer (sql.js)
  email-sender.js      # SMTP and Gmail API email sending
  template-engine.js   # Placeholder personalization and HTML utilities
  importer.js          # Excel/CSV file parsing
  scheduler.js         # Background email scheduler (30s interval)
  data/
    templates.json     # Pre-built email templates
    tracker.db         # SQLite database (auto-created)
  public/
    index.html         # SPA entry point
    app.js             # Frontend JavaScript
    style.css          # Styles
  uploads/             # Temporary file upload directory

Setup

  1. Install dependencies:

    cd standalone
    npm install
  2. Configure environment — create standalone/.env:

    # SMTP (Gmail App Password)
    SMTP_USER=you@gmail.com
    SMTP_PASS=your-app-password
    
    # OR Google OAuth (for Gmail API drafts/sending)
    GOOGLE_CLIENT_ID=your-client-id
    GOOGLE_CLIENT_SECRET=your-client-secret
    GOOGLE_REDIRECT_URI=http://localhost:3000/auth/google/callback
    
    # Optional
    PORT=3000
    SESSION_SECRET=your-secret
    TIMEZONE=Asia/Kolkata
    ADMIN_EMAILS=you@gmail.com
  3. Start the server:

    npm start        # production
    npm run dev      # development (auto-restart on changes)
  4. Open http://localhost:3000 in your browser.

API Endpoints

Method Path Description
POST /auth/send-otp Send login OTP
POST /auth/verify-otp Verify OTP and log in
GET /auth/google Start Google OAuth flow
GET /auth/status Check login and config status
GET /api/contacts List contacts (paginated, searchable)
POST /api/contacts/add Add a single contact
POST /api/contacts/import Import contacts from file
GET /api/contacts/export Export contacts as CSV
PUT /api/contacts/:id Update a contact
DELETE /api/contacts/:id Delete a contact
GET /api/templates List all templates
POST /api/templates/load Activate a template
PUT /api/templates/:key Edit a template
POST /api/drafts/single Create one draft
POST /api/drafts/bulk Create drafts in bulk
POST /api/drafts/:id/send Send a specific draft
POST /api/drafts/send-all Send all pending drafts
POST /api/drafts/test-self Send test email to yourself
POST /api/schedule/preview Preview scheduled send times
POST /api/schedule/start Start scheduled sending
POST /api/schedule/cancel Cancel all scheduled emails
GET /api/progress SSE stream for real-time progress

Database Tables

Table Purpose
users Registered users with OTP fields
contacts Job application contacts (per user)
email_log Scheduled/sent email records
batch_log Batch run summaries
drafts Local email drafts for review before sending
settings Per-user key-value settings
audit_log Action history
blocklist Blocked emails/domains

Personalization

Templates support these placeholders which are auto-replaced per contact:

Tag Description
{{name}} Recruiter / contact name
{{company}} Company name
{{role_name}} Job title / role
{{email}} Recruiter email
{{location}} Job location
{{platform}} Source platform (LinkedIn, Naukri, etc.)
{{portfolio_link}} Your portfolio URL (configurable in Settings)

Set your portfolio link, default role name, and email signature in the Settings panel after logging in.
